Evil and Redemption

Evil and Redemption

by Elie Wiesel




Last Sunday's show featured the last of the 2004 lecture series, "The Fascination with Jewish Tales," by teacher, author, and Nobel Peace Prize winner, Elie Wiesel.

In this lecture, titled "Evil and Redemption," Wiesel discussed the root of evil, and the notion of redemption, which, according to him, "begins when indifference ends."

Wiesel has been delivering his annual three-lecture series "The Fascination with Jewish Tales" at Boston University since 1975.



LearnOutLoud.com Review:

 Wiesel on Evil
For this streaming audio lecture released by World of Ideas, Nobel Peace Prize Winner Elie Wiesel endeavors to define humanity''s concept of evil and formulates the ways in which we all may fight it. Starting by examining our earliest conception of sin in the story of Adam and Eve, Wiesel redefines how human beings have interacted with evil and how it can''t be completely divided from good.

For him, history''s greatest atrocities and wars were allowed to happen by good people, and in the end he argues that the real struggle against evil is in how we fight our apathy towards it.
